Just so people reading this thread understand, the "buggy" nature of X5 on the Osmo isn't related to the adapter, it's just the firmware. Or lack of firmware. The interference with the joystick button is also not related the adapter. I sanded my Osmo down to get the X5 to fit and had the same interference with the joystick. I just sanded the joystick down so that I could still use it rather than pulling it off completely.

I personally wouldn't want to replace the metal collar with a plastic 3d printed collar and trust my X5 on it, but that's probably just being paranoid.

You have to remove the thumb control so its just reacting to where you point it. Or you can control it by dragging you finger around on the app screen.

All 4k & 1080p & 720p modes work except the 120fps mode. This is coming in the future though.
Manual mode is the only not buggy mode. With the latest iOS version of DJI Go App in manual you can control ISO, APERTURE, SHUTTER.
Focus is tap to focus. Its a little slow more so in low light.
My X5 in running the latest inspire pro firmware.
Osmo is factory firmware handle kit.
iOS DJI Go App is the latest public release.
No fancy panoramic or time-lapse modes work yet.
